AI Engineer _ GitHub Copilot Agents
AI Engineer with strong hands-on experience in building GitHub Copilot-based AI agents to accelerate Salesforce development and testing. The role will focus on leveraging agentic AI and prompt engineering to automate SDLC activities and improve delivery efficiency.
Job Description
Must Have Technical/Functional Skills
- Hands-on experience with GitHub Copilot for development and testing automation
- Proven ability to build AI agents / Copilot-driven workflows
- Strong Salesforce development experience (Apex, LWC, integrations)
- Strong Python programming skills (mandatory)
- Experience in Prompt Engineering and prompt optimization
- Experience working with LLMs (GPT, Claude, etc.)
- Knowledge of:
- Test automation frameworks
- SDLC lifecycle automation
- API and integration patterns
Preferred Skills
- Experience implementing agentic development in Salesforce ecosystem
- Exposure to:
- Agentforce / Salesforce AI / enterprise AI tools
- CI/CD pipelines with AI automation
- Experience building:
- Multi-agent workflows
- Autonomous testing solutions
Roles & Responsibilities
- Copilot Agent Development (Core Responsibility)
- Design and build AI agents using GitHub Copilot to support:
- Salesforce development (Apex, LWC, integrations)
- Automated testing and QA workflows
- Enable Copilot-driven code generation, refactoring, and debugging across SDLC
- Design and build AI agents using GitHub Copilot to support:
- Salesforce Development Enablement
- Leverage AI and Copilot to accelerate:
- Apex / LWC development
- API integrations and backend logic
- Code modernization and enhancements
- Convert design artifacts (e.g., Figma inputs where applicable) into code scaffolding and components (based on Copilot usage patterns observed in internal PoCs)
- Leverage AI and Copilot to accelerate:
- AI-Driven Testing & Automation
- Build AI agents to automate:
- Test case generation
- Unit test creation and execution
- Regression and functional testing
- Use Copilot to improve test coverage, reduce manual effort, and enable TDD adoption
- Support transition toward AI-assisted/autonomous testing pipelines
- Build AI agents to automate:
- Prompt Engineering & Optimization
- Design and optimize prompts using:
- Few-shot, structured prompting techniques
- Build prompt templates and reusable patterns for development and testing use cases
- Continuously refine prompts for better accuracy and context relevance
- Design and optimize prompts using:
- Python & AI Integration
- Develop backend services and automation scripts using Python
- Integrate AI agents with:
- Salesforce platforms
- DevOps pipelines
- APIs and enterprise applications
- LLM & Agentic Frameworks
- Implement solutions using LLMs (GPT, Claude, or similar)
- Build AI workflows using:
- RAG (Retrieval-Augmented Generation)
- Frameworks like LangChain (or equivalent)
- Collaboration & Delivery
- Work closely with Salesforce teams, QA, and architects
- Participate in sprint delivery with embedded AI workflows
- Drive adoption of AI-led SDLC transformation
